AJ Styles hung up his wrestling boots after losing to Gunther at the 2026 Royal Rumble.

WWE is set to hold a special tribute segment for Styles on the February 23, 2026, episode of Monday Night Raw. The Phenomenal One is scheduled to address the WWE Universe “one final time” during the broadcast. Talents from SmackDown are reportedly being flown in to take part in the ceremony, making it a company-wide celebration.

While it appears that Styles will deliver a heartfelt goodbye promo before riding off into the sunset, WWE could still pull the trigger on a surprise that fans may not see coming.

1. AJ Styles Takes Up On-Screen Authority Figure Role

AJ Styles has previously stated in interviews that he would like to remain connected with WWE even after his in-ring retirement. Given his veteran credibility and deep knowledge of the business, WWE could keep him involved in a non-wrestling capacity. One possibility is appointing Styles as an on-screen authority figure on Raw this week.

2. Styles’ Hall of Fame Induction

AJ Styles enjoyed a three-decade-long wrestling career, including a highly successful decade in WWE. To cement his wrestling legacy forever, the company could announce his induction into the WWE Hall of Fame as part of the Class of 2026 on Raw.

3. Clash with Gunther

Gunther is the man who ended AJ Styles’ in-ring career. Like a true heel, he could interrupt Styles’ celebration on Raw, sparking one final confrontation. This could potentially lure The Phenomenal One back into the ring for one last match, setting the stage for a showdown at WrestleMania 42.

Many fans were unhappy with AJ Styles’ retirement at the Royal Rumble, and such an angle would allow him to receive a more fitting and emotional send-off on WWE’s grandest stage.
